The Employer Relations Assistant (Morning Shift) will have the unique opportunity to welcome and assist employers and students who come to Charlottesville to conduct on-Grounds interviews. The Employer Relations Assistant will provide administrative support and coverage for on-Grounds Interviews on the 4th floor of Bryant Hall in Scott Stadium. The Employer Relations Assistant will also learn about on-Grounds recruitment, customer service, and how to build relationships with employers. Morning Shift Responsibilities: 7:00am-9:00am Monday - Thursday
  • Greet employers as they arrive and check-in for On-Grounds Interviewing
  • Assist in the morning preparation of On-Grounds Interviews
  • Oversee the student kiosk and assist students in the check-in/check-out process as needed
  • Reset, restock, and open interview suites as needed, set up and restock employer lounge, student lounge, and OGI lobby as needed
  • Other Employer Relations duties as assigned
